Choosing the right substitute can sometimes feel overwhelming, especially given the vast array of options available. Making a smart choice requires a blend of awareness and experimentation. Consider these tips for an informed decision:
Prioritize Your Dietary Needs
Are you vegan, gluten-free, or have allergies to certain ingredients? These factors are crucial in shaping your choices. If you're searching for a meat substitute, consider plant-based options like tofu, tempeh, or even jackfruit. Similarly, if you're navigating gluten sensitivities, focus on naturally gluten-free alternatives such as rice noodles or cauliflower-based crusts.
Embrace Texture and Flavor
Some foods are celebrated for their textures, while others are all about the flavor. As you consider replacements, try to align these elements as closely as possible. If you're craving something crunchy, consider baked or air-fried alternatives. For creamy textures, experiment with avocado, or cashew-based sauces. Thinking this way can make substitutes more effective.

Kimchi Fried Rice
A classic Korean dish, kimchi fried rice, offers a delightful solution for satisfying cravings. Packed with flavor, it's incredibly customizable to match your tastes. Moreover, it's an excellent way to utilize leftover rice, minimizing food waste while maximizing taste.
Bulgogi Bowls
Bulgogi bowls present a healthier alternative to traditional Korean barbecue. You can prepare them with lean cuts of meat or plant-based options like marinated tofu or mushrooms, offering a satisfying experience akin to the real thing.
Spicy Tofu Stir-Fry
For those who appreciate a spicy kick, a tofu stir-fry, seasoned with gochujang sauce, is a must-try. This dish is packed with protein and a vibrant flavor profile, making it an excellent temporary substitute for meat-based dishes.
Korean Pancakes
Korean pancakes, or pajeon, are a delicious and filling choice, perfect for satisfying savory cravings. They're simple to make and can be enjoyed as a snack or a meal.
